The limp re-raise is either a QQ+ or something like A3s, a small pp or junk. This one looks especially like junk. I think the last 5 times I was limp reraised it was small pps, weak aces or junk. It's generally obvious because I'll have a read that the guy is just gambling. When the 50/1/0.4 does it, then it's time to watch out. The last time I was limp re-raised it was limped to me on the button, I raised with JTs, an EP limper who I knew to be a random gambler makes it 3, so I cap for equity. The flop comes KQ3, I bet ever street when checked to and he called down with A3s. Good times. Anyway, I think it's much more common for this to be gambling fun these days.

Edit: Also, I almost always check behind when someone makes an out of tempo (just for you miles) check unless I have a good reason to think he's making a defensive check.
